Definitions:

Neuron

A unique cell that carries nerve signals, referred to as a nerve cell.

Occipital

Pertaining to the occipital lobe in the brain, located at the back, primarily responsible for visual processing.

Primary Visual Cortex

A region in the occipital lobe of the brain responsible for processing visual information from the eyes.

Immune-System Response

The reaction of the immune system in defending the body against pathogens, including viruses, bacteria, and other harmful organisms.
